HELIX RAY is an intimate UK-based music project exploring themes of love, war, politics, spiritualism, nature, mythicism, malady, melancholy and more. With thought-provoking lyrics and rhythms, you are given time to reflect on fears and emotions, offering an almost cathartic experience.
For the sound HELIX RAY delved into a variety of his favourite genres of music, finding inspiration from alternative folk, rock, ska, electronica, and even a hint of 80's west coast mysticism. Growing up around folk music and its performative nature, his fondness of rootsy melodies with innovative percussion, raw-edged dramatic vocals, harmonies and visceral lyrics have inspired this project.
Through HELIX RAY’s persona he reflects on the idiosyncrasies and oxymorons in our world today. With burgeoning conflicting opinions of governments, news, social media, health issues, alternative therapies and otherworldliness, we seem to be misplacing our modesty and empathy. HELIX RAY gives process in thought to rekindle oneself in an ever-controlling and scrutinising system, as well as a creative way to face the indifference and strive for hope.
Shaped by years of writing, performance and numerous creative projects and alongside a career in rehabilitation with the injured and the elderly, he cherished, failed and got up again, circling back to his true love of music and art. HELIX RAY is a narration about picking yourself up from your own passion when all else has failed.

Collaborators
HELIX RAY's personal and musical journey wouldn't have been possible without the contribution of Mike Benn, offering his skills as a musician and producer in the picturesque mountains of Spain at Olive Groove, coupled with the captivating warmth of Carla Maria Jennings’ vocals on “Bracken Calls”, "Medicine We Speak" and "Creepin Jesus".
